Cormorant Island
Cormorant Island is an island in Yorke Peninsula and Clare Valley, South Australia. Cormorant Island is situated nearby to the locality Red Cliffs.- Type: Island
- Description: island in South Australia, Australia
- Also known as: “Cormorant Islet” and “Little Goose Island”

Goose Island
Island
Goose Island is a small, rocky island lying about 550 m from the northern end of the much larger Wardang Island, off the west coast of the Yorke Peninsula, in the Spencer Gulf of South Australia.
